<p>Probabilities occur in many applications of computer science, such as communication theory and artificial intelligence. These are critical applications that require some form of verification to guarantee the quality of their implementations. Unfortunately, probabilities are also the typical example of a mathematical theory whose abuses of notations make pencil-and-paper proofs difficult to formalize. In this paper, we experiment a new formalization of conditional probabilities that we validate with two applications. First, we formalize the foundational definitions and theorems of information theory, extending previous work with new lemmas. Second, we formalize the notion of conditional independence and its properties, paving the road for a formalization of probabilistic graphical models.</p>
